Genel Bakış
ASSM altında, Bloğun alan kullanımı 5 duruma bölünmüştür: boş alan:% 0-25,% 25-50,% 50-75,% 70-100 ve Tam Show_space_assm, sayılacak tablo için bu 5 tip blokların sayısını özetleyecektir. Pratik bir saklı yordamı paylaşalım, ASSM tablosunda blokların kullanımını görebilirsiniz.
Saklı yordam
show_space_assm ( varchar2'de p_segname, varchar2 varsayılan kullanıcısında p_owner, p_type, varchar2 default'TABLE 'içinde) gibi l_fs1_bytes sayısı; l_fs2_bytes sayısı; l_fs3_bytes sayısı; l_fs4_bytes sayısı; l_fs1_blocks numarası; l_fs2_blocks numarası; l_fs3_blocks numarası; l_fs4_blocks numarası; l_full_bytes sayısı; l_full_blocks numarası; l_unformatted_bytes sayısı; l_unformatted_blocks numarası; prosedür p (varchar2'de p_label, sayı olarak p_num) dır-dir başla dbms_output.put_line (rpad (p_label, 40, '.') || p_num); son; başla dbms_space.space_usage ( segment_owner = > p_owner, segment_name = > p_segname, segment_type = > p_type, fs1_bytes = > l_fs1_bytes, fs1_blocks = > l_fs1_blocks, fs2_bytes = > l_fs2_bytes, fs2_blocks = > l_fs2_blocks, fs3_bytes = > l_fs3_bytes, fs3_blocks = > l_fs3_blocks, fs4_bytes = > l_fs4_bytes, fs4_blocks = > l_fs4_blocks, full_bytes = > l_full_bytes, full_blocks = > l_full_blocks, unformatted_blocks = > l_unformatted_blocks, unformatted_bytes = > l_unformatted_bytes); p ('boş alan 0-25% Bloklar:', l_fs1_blocks); p ('boş alan% 25-50 Bloklar:', l_fs2_blocks); p ('boş alan% 50-75 Bloklar:', l_fs3_blocks); p ('boş alan 75-100% Bloklar:', l_fs4_blocks); p ('Tam Bloklar:', l_full_blocks); p ('Biçimlendirilmemiş bloklar:', l_unformatted_blocks); son; /
Sonuçları Görüntüle
SQL > serveroutput'u aç
SQL > exec show_space_assm ('TEST_HWM', 'NWPP');
Buraya tablo adını ilk parametreye ve karşılık gelen kullanıcı adını ikinci parametreye yazın.
Bunların arasında% 25-50 boş alana sahip 0 blok,% 50-75 boş alana sahip 0 blok,% 75-100 boş alana sahip 0 blok ve Dolu sadece 2 blok bulunmaktadır. Bu durumda, bu tablonun mevcut veri satırlarının yeniden düzenlenmesine gerek yoktur.
DBA hakkında daha fazlasını daha sonra paylaşacağım, ilgilenen arkadaşlar buna dikkat edebilir! !
-
- Anime'deki annenin toprağa gömülü olduğu kadar eğlenceli olan yeni bir türü var ve Amelia onu kovalamanıza yardımcı olacak
-
- Bazı ebeveynler aslında çocuklarına bu tür bir "eğitici video" gösterir, lütfen hemen durun!
-
- PLC'yi iyi öğrenmek istiyorsanız, bu PPT'yi şiddetle tavsiye ederim, bu en kapsamlı öğrenme materyali!
-
- Hayran Katkısı: iTunes fotoğraf albümü senkronizasyonundaki sorunlar bugün sizin için çözüldü!
-
- Hindistan'dan yerli bir makine satın almalısınız! OnePlus bu telefon çok sıcak, ancak iki kez satın almak isterseniz stokta yok!
-
- Animasyon tarzı değişti, Taiyi siyah oldu, Mikasa yaşlandı ve sonsuza dek başa çıkmak kolay Lianghua
-
- Akış ölçümünde Siemens S7-200PLC uygulaması, kümülatif miktar nasıl ölçülür!
-
- 2018 "Tiger Fighting" Brifingi
-
- Koga Tomoe, Azusagawa Sakita'nın kalbini alamadı ve Eluru, Huck Oro'yu kaybetti
-
- IP kuralı, ip yolu ve iptables arasındaki ilişkiyi ayrıntılı olarak açıklayın
-
- Mitsubishi PLC ve programlama yazılımı ayrıntılı çalışması (resim)
-
- İPhone paylaşımı burada, onu kullanır mısın?